Latest Patents
Fujiki holds a patent for a dental cutting tool holder. This invention is designed to prevent sliding between the cutting tool and collet chuck during high-speed rotation. It ensures the secure positioning of the cutting tool, which is critical for precision in dental procedures. The design includes a collet chuck that allows for detachable insertion of the dental cutting tool, a rotor that drives the collet chuck for rotation, and a clamping member that maintains the integrity of the tool's position.
Career Highlights
Setsuo Fujiki is associated with J. Morita Manufacturing Corporation, a company known for its advancements in dental equipment.
